At my work, our team sends all day events to each other when out of the
office. How can I prevent these events from being marked as tentative on my calendar? On the owner's calendar they the event is marked as free. As a attendee the event appears tentative thus blocking my whole day. I don't want someones all day event block my calendar. What can I do? We use Outlook 2003 |
